测试交流

Unittest断言(六)

定义和作用:自动化测试中如期结果与实际结果的对比 基本的断言方法提供了测试结果是True还是False。所有的断言方法都有一个msg参数,如果指定msg参数的值,则将该信息作为失败的错误信息返回。 Skip操作(无条件跳过):(以下代码示例...
阅读全文
开发测试

Python类中的self的作用是什么?

Python编写类的时候,每个函数参数第一个参数都是self,一开始我不管它到底是干嘛的,只知道必须要写上。后来对Python渐渐熟悉了一点,再回头看self的概念,似乎有点弄明白了。 首先明确的是self只有在类的方法中才会有,独立的函数...
阅读全文
开发测试

Python中的**kwargs中介绍和使用方式

一、含义 - 1、*args和**kwargs主要用于定义函数的可变参数 2、*args:发送一个非键值对的可变数量的参数列表给函数 3、**kwargs:发送一个键值对的可变数量的参数列表给函数 4、如果想要在函数内使用带有名称的变量(像...
阅读全文